As a Manager in HR M&A Transactions, you will play a key role in delivering complex, people‑focused M&A and restructuring engagements. You will act as a trusted advisor to clients while providing strong leadership across delivery teams.

  • Lead key people workstreams across M&A engagements across the full deal lifecycle, including Due Diligence, Sell & Separate and Buy & Integrate.
  • Shape and deliver people‑led transformation programmes that enhance organisational performance and maximise deal value.
  • Support in the preparation of high‑quality RFP responses and client proposals, ensuring timely, professional and compelling submissions.
  • Ensure full compliance with EY’s Quality and Risk Management (QRM) requirements, from client acceptance through to programme close.
  • Build and maintain strong, trusted relationships with clients and multi‑disciplinary EY delivery teams.
  • Uphold EY’s quality, risk and commercial standards across all engagements.
  • Contribute to strengthening EY’s reputation as a trusted advisor in HR M&A and people‑led transformation.

We are seeking a Manager with strong delivery credentials and emerging commercial leadership:

  • Experience across HR M&A, HR transformation, restructuring and people consulting.
  • Proven ability to lead complex HR workstreams in both domestic and international contexts, working with diverse EY and client teams.
  • Strong focus on the employee proposition, with a clear understanding of key risks, best practices and delivery within agreed time, cost and risk parameters.
  • Excellent stakeholder management skills, with confidence engaging senior client leadership.
  • Strong analytical capability combined with clear, structured communication and high‑impact presentation skills.
  • Experience across both buy‑side and sell‑side transactions, as well as organisational restructuring.
  • Experience working in large, global or highly regulated environments.
